General view of the area now covered by the New England Quarter, a large mixed-use development next to Brighton railway station in the City of Brighton and Hove, England. This photo (scanned from the original) was taken in 1996 from Howard Place in the West Hill area of the city. Dominating the view is the station car park. Above the tall pole at the end of the station platform is St Martin's Church; the large building to the right of centre is St Bartholomew's Church
